MountainHouse
MountainHouse
Misiaszek Turpin pllcMisiaszek Turpin pllc
Resting upon a 120-acre rural hillside, this 17,500 square-foot residence has unencumbered mountain views to the east, south and west. The exterior design palette for the public side is a more formal Tudor style of architecture, including intricate brick detailing; while the materials for the private side tend toward a more casual mountain-home style of architecture with a natural stone base and hand-cut wood siding. Primary living spaces and the master bedroom suite, are located on the main level, with guest accommodations on the upper floor of the main house and upper floor of the garage. The interior material palette was carefully chosen to match the stunning collection of antique furniture and artifacts, gathered from around the country. From the elegant kitchen to the cozy screened porch, this residence captures the beauty of the White Mountains and embodies classic New Hampshire living. Photographer: Joseph St. Pierre

Cliff Drive
Cliff Drive
Michael H. Masilotti ArchitectsMichael H. Masilotti Architects
Custom ocean front four bedroom five bath craftsman remodel. This three story residence maintains a low profile from the street and exposes itself to the breathtaking views of Shaws Cove. A spectacular great room with sliding French pocket doors that lead out to a sizeable deck. This home was designed for entertaining. A very private outdoor room with every amenity you could ask for is tucked below on the first floor and has a private access stair to the beach. It is connected to the kitchen with a dumbwaiter for convenience. There is a wine room, theater, office and garage parking for three cars.
